Leeward Investments LLC MA lessened its holdings in Clean Harbors, Inc. (NYSE:CLH - Free Report) by 2.8% during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 144,974 shares of the business services provider's stock after selling 4,244 shares during the quarter. Clean Harbors makes up approximately 1.7% of Leeward Investments LLC MA's holdings, making the stock its 4th biggest holding. Leeward Investments LLC MA owned about 0.27% of Clean Harbors worth $33,993,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Clean Harbors Stock Performance

Shares of CLH opened at $308.05 on Friday.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.99, a quick ratio of 1.99 and a current ratio of 2.34. Clean Harbors, Inc. has a twelve month low of $201.34 and a twelve month high of $316.98. The firm's 50 day moving average price is $295.27 and its two-hundred day moving average price is $262.79. The firm has a market cap of $16.28 billion, a P/E ratio of 41.74 and a beta of 0.92.

Clean Harbors (NYSE:CLH -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, May 6th. The business services provider reported $1.19 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.15 by $0.04. Clean Harbors had a net margin of 6.53% and a return on equity of 14.37%. The firm had revenue of $1.46 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.47 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$1.09 earnings per share. The business's revenue was up 1.9% on a year-over-year basis. On average, analysts forecast that Clean Harbors, Inc. will post 8.38 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About Clean Harbors

(Free Report)

Clean Harbors, Inc is a leading provider of environmental, energy and industrial services in North America. The company specializes in the collection, transportation and disposal of hazardous and non-hazardous wastes, emergency spill response and remediation, industrial cleaning and on-site field services. Its comprehensive service offering also includes chemical neutralization, drum crushing, high-pressure water blasting, tank cleaning and vacuum services designed to help customers meet stringent environmental regulations.
